6" PROCOMP W/37's~Coilover Question~ Pics!!

Hey guys the past two days me and my friend put my 6" stage I procomp lift on. I ran 37's with some minor trimming of the lower plastic valance.

I know i will find osme places it will rub as i drive it more.

I had a 2.5" AS leveling spacer i was going to run, i had it in the set up but i could NOT get the upper ball joint to go into the knuckle. so i decided not to run it, i was also a little wearry about it, stacking spacer-- not good.

So i wanna pick up some procomp coilovers the next day or so, now when you crank the coilover can you crank it AFTER you install it into the truck? or do you need to do it before its in the truck? The reason asking is i want to get about an inch more of lift to run the 37's and i wanna make sure i can get the top ball joint into the knuckle.
so thanks for the answers guys here are some of the pics.

Truck looks great , if you want more lift but want a cheaper route then coilovers get some bilstein 5100's in the front and put at the 2" lift snap ring on the shock , will ride great and not anywhere near the expense of coilovers. Just another option
